利用剪刀石头布之间的逻辑关系 以及枚举类型enum 就可以很方便地解决问题
参考代码:
#include<iostream> using namespace std; int main() { enum caiquan{shitou,bu,jiandao}; int a,b; while(cin>>a>>b) { if(a==shitou&&b==jiandao||a==jiandao&&b==bu||a==bu&&b==shitou) cout<<"1"<<endl; else if(b==shitou&&a==jiandao||b==jiandao&&a==bu||b==bu&&a==shitou) cout<<"-1"<<endl; else cout<<"0"<<endl; } return 0; }
0.0分
3 人评分
C语言程序设计教程(第三版)课后习题10.7 (C语言代码)浏览:689 |
The 3n + 1 problem (C语言代码)浏览:1340 |
C语言程序设计教程(第三版)课后习题1.5 (C语言代码)浏览:565 |
点我有惊喜!你懂得!浏览:1403 |
C语言程序设计教程(第三版)课后习题8.8 (C语言代码)浏览:580 |
校门外的树 (C语言代码)浏览:1123 |
C语言程序设计教程(第三版)课后习题7.2 (Java代码)浏览:686 |
C语言训练-角谷猜想 (C++代码)(3N+1问题)浏览:1750 |
C语言训练-大、小写问题 (C语言代码)浏览:2357 |
C语言程序设计教程(第三版)课后习题8.3 (C语言代码)浏览:1099 |